Jon Stewart provided a recap on Wednesday of this year’s elections in New York City, Virginia and New Jersey.

In the Garden State, where Gov. Chris Christie (R) won re-election in a landslide, Stewart mused that the 2016 contender celebrated by “weirding everybody out.”

“Tonight, first and foremost, I want to say thank you, New Jersey, for making me the luckiest guy in the world,” Christie said during his victory speech.

That line prompted a classic Stewart reaction.

“Did New Jersey marry Chris Christie last night?” the host joked.
